Catalan[edit]

Etymology[edit]

Borrowed from Italian tombolo, from Latin tumulus. Doublet of túmul.

Pronunciation[edit]

Noun[edit]

tómbol m (plural tómbols)

  1. tombolo (sandy spit connecting an island to the mainland)
